WebBronchopulmonary dysplasia (BPD), also known as chronic lung disease, causes long-term breathing problems in premature babies. The condition often results in poor growth and development. An estimated 10,000 to 15,000 babies in the United States develop BPD each year. There is no cure, but it can be treated and most babies go on to live a long ...
